Filter test fixture to chains actually present in current merged output
Latest CI run confirmed all remaining balances-test failures (50 of 160) were java.util.NoSuchElementException for chain ids no longer in the app's config - both newly-blacklisted chains and a handful of retired testnets (Westmint, Moonbase Alpha/Relay, Aleph Zero Testnet, an old Xode id, RegionX) that the raw Nova fixture still references. None were real balance/fee assertion failures - the app itself is working correctly for every chain it actually has configured. sync_tests() now filters chains_for_testBalance.json down to entries whose chainId exists in the latest merged chains.json (v22, 80 -> 56 entries) instead of publishing Nova's fixture verbatim, so the test only ever exercises chains the app can actually resolve - and stays correct automatically as chains.json changes, instead of needing separate manual upkeep alongside blocked-chains.json.
